什么平台借钱容易下款,正规借钱平台哪个靠谱

旺财             来源:有财网
旺财 贷款顾问

构建一个解决用户查询“什么平台借钱”的金融信息聚合平台,核心在于构建一个高并发、高合规性的数据匹配引擎,这不仅仅是简单的列表展示,而是涉及多源数据清洗、实时风控对接以及精准推荐算法的复杂系统工程,开发者必须将合规性置于首位,确保所有接入的金融机构均持有合法牌照,从而为用户提供权威、可信的借贷信息服务,以下是基于金融科技最佳实践的开发教程,旨在指导开发者构建一个安全、高效且符合E-E-A-T原则的金融产品分发系统。

什么平台借钱容易下款

系统架构设计:微服务与高可用 为了保证系统在流量高峰期的稳定性,建议采用微服务架构进行开发,这种架构能够将用户服务、产品服务、风控服务解耦,提升系统的扩展性和维护性。

  • 网关层设计:使用Nginx或Kong作为API网关,负责统一入口、SSL证书卸载以及基础的限流熔断配置,针对敏感接口,必须配置严格的IP白名单和频率限制,防止恶意爬虫抓取平台数据。
  • 服务拆分策略
    • 用户中心:负责注册、登录、实名认证(KYC)及权限管理。
    • 产品中心:管理各类贷款产品的元数据,包括额度、利率、期限等。
    • 匹配引擎:核心计算模块,负责根据用户画像计算匹配分数。
    • 订单中心:处理申请流程的异步状态更新。
  • 消息队列应用:引入RabbitMQ或Kafka处理异步任务,如将用户的申请记录推送到第三方金融机构,避免因第三方接口响应慢而阻塞主线程,提升用户体验。
  1. 多源数据接入与标准化 在开发过程中,数据接入层是连接用户与金融机构的桥梁,当用户在系统中检索什么平台借钱时,后端并非实时抓取,而是调用预处理的标准化接口。
  • 统一API适配器:不同的金融机构(银行、消费金融公司)提供的API接口标准各异,开发时需设计适配器模式,将第三方差异化的数据结构(JSON/XML)转换为平台内部统一的标准数据模型(ProductModel)。
  • 数据清洗机制
    • 去重逻辑:基于产品名称和机构ID建立唯一索引,防止重复展示。
    • 时效性校验:每个产品数据必须附带expire_time字段,系统需通过定时任务(Cron Job)每分钟扫描失效数据,自动下架过期产品,确保用户看到的信息永远是最新的。
  • 异常处理与重试:第三方接口可能存在不稳定性,在代码中实现指数退避重试机制,当请求失败时,分别在第1秒、第2秒、第4秒进行重试,三次失败后触发报警通知运维人员。

智能匹配与推荐算法 为了提高转化率,不能简单罗列产品,而需要开发一套基于规则的推荐算法,将最合适的平台优先展示给用户。

  • 用户画像构建:在用户授权的前提下,收集基础信息(年龄、职业、收入、社保公积金缴纳情况),将这些信息量化为特征向量,has_social_security = 1salary_level = 3
  • 准入规则引擎:使用Drools或自研规则引擎,配置硬性过滤条件。
    • 示例规则:如果用户年龄 < 22岁,则过滤掉所有要求“年龄22+”的产品。
    • 示例规则:如果用户征信报告中有逾期记录,则屏蔽所有对征信要求为“无逾期”的产品。
  • 排序算法:通过加权打分对产品进行排序,公式示例:Score = (0.4 * 通过率预估) + (0.3 * 额度匹配度) + (0.3 * 平台佣金权重),分数越高的产品排在列表越前方,既满足用户需求,也兼顾商业价值。

安全合规体系构建 金融类程序开发必须严格遵守《个人信息保护法》及相关金融监管要求,安全是系统的生命线。

  • 数据加密存储
    • 传输加密:全站强制开启HTTPS,并配置TLS 1.2及以上版本,防止中间人攻击。
    • 存储加密:对于用户的身份证号、手机号、银行卡号等PII(个人敏感信息),严禁明文存储,使用AES-256算法进行加密,密钥与数据库分离管理(如使用KMS密钥管理服务)。
  • 防刷与反欺诈
    • 设备指纹:集成SDK获取设备唯一标识,识别模拟器、群控设备。
    • 行为验证:在关键操作(如点击“立即申请”)前,弹出滑块验证或点选验证,防止自动化脚本恶意刷单。
  • 合规性展示:在前端页面底部必须通过配置文件动态渲染备案信息、ICP许可证号以及风险提示语(如“借贷有风险,选择需谨慎”),这些内容不应硬编码在HTML中,以便于统一更新。

数据库设计与性能优化 合理的数据库设计是支撑高并发查询的基础。

  • 表结构设计
    • products表:包含机构ID、产品名称、最小/最大额度、日利率范围、适用人群标签,对status(上架状态)和sort_order(排序权重)建立联合索引。
    • user_apply_logs表:记录用户每一次申请行为,包含用户ID、产品ID、申请时间、状态(成功/失败/审核中),此表数据量巨大,建议按月进行分表(Sharding)处理。
  • 缓存策略
    • 使用Redis缓存热门产品列表,设置合理的过期时间(如5分钟),采用“Cache-Aside”模式:先读缓存,缓存未命中则读数据库并回写缓存。
    • 对首页等高频访问页面开启页面级静态化或CDN加速,减轻源服务器压力。

前端交互与用户体验 前端开发需注重简洁与专业,避免过多的视觉干扰,引导用户快速完成决策。

  • 筛选功能开发:提供多维度的筛选栏,包括“额度范围”、“期限长短”、“放款速度”,筛选逻辑应在前端通过JS快速响应,减少不必要的后端请求。
  • 贷款计算器:嵌入一个实时的JavaScript计算器,当用户拖动滑块选择金额和期限时,实时计算“总利息”和“每月还款额”,公式需精确到小数点后两位,算法需与后端保持一致。
  • 加载优化:采用骨架屏技术替代传统的Loading转圈,在数据请求返回前展示页面灰度轮廓,减少用户感知的等待时间,提升心理体验。

通过以上步骤,开发者可以构建一个技术架构稳健、数据安全可靠且用户体验优良的金融信息服务平台,这不仅解决了用户对于什么平台借钱的信息获取需求,更通过专业的技术手段保障了信息的真实性与匹配的精准度。

【原创声明】凡注明“来源:有财网”的文章,系本站原创,任何单位或个人未经本站书面授权不得转载、链接、转贴或以其他方式复制发表。否则,本站将依法追究其法律责任。

AI炒股神器

推荐产品